Contents |
1. Material challenges and perspectives / Daiwon Choi, Wei Wang, and Zhenguo Yang -- 2. Cathode materials for lithium-ion batteries / Zhumabay Bakenov and Izumi Taniguchi -- 3. Anode materials for lithium-ion batteries / Ricardo Alcántara [and others] -- 4. Electrolytes for lithium-ion batteries / Alexandra Lex-Balducci, Wesley Henderson, and Stefano Passerini -- 5. Separators for lithium-ion batteries / Shriram Santhanagopalan and Zhengming (John) Zhang -- 6. First-principles methods in the modeling of li-ion battery materials / John S. Tse and Jianjun Yang -- 7. A multidimensional, electrochemical-thermal coupled lithium-ion battery model / Gang Luo and Chao-Yang Wang -- 8. State-of-the-art production technology of cathode and anode materials for lithium-ion batteries / Guoxian Liang and Dean D. MacNeil. |
